The GCSE Combined Science curriculum provides comprehensive coverage of biology, chemistry, and physics concepts essential for secondary students.
Key topics in Biology Paper 1 include cell biology, organization, infection and response, and bioenergetics. Students learn about cell structure, transport systems, disease prevention, and photosynthesis. Biology Paper 2 topics AQA covers homeostasis, inheritance, variation, evolution, and ecology. Chemistry sections explore atomic structure, bonding, quantitative chemistry, chemical changes, and energy changes.
